Parmesan Meatballs

1.5 lbs Ground Beef

3/4 C Shredded Parmesan cheese

2 eggs

1 tsp Dried Parsley

Dash of Pepper

2-3 T Butter

15oz Can of Tomato Sauce

1 Clove Garlic

1/2 tsp Onion powder

1/4 tsp Basil

1/8 tsp Oregano

Combine beef, cheese, eggs, parsley & pepper until well mixed then shape into meatballs. Melt butter in a large skillet and cook until all sides are browned. Place browned meatballs in the crock pot or a casserole dish suitable for the oven.

Combine the tomato sauce, garlic, onion powder, basil & oregano. Pour over the meatballs, stirring gently to coat.

Turn crock pot on low for 1-4 hours OR bake, uncovered in an oven at 350 for 30-40 minutes.

**I make them in the crock pot and although the recipe says 1-4 hours, I let them cook on low for 6-7 hours ... they turn out really tender and oh so yummy!**

gergia girl how do u make your homemade ice coffee?thanks

Sorry, it took so long. I've been sick and haven't been online much. I just mixed together: 1 cup of skim milk, some Water (about 1/2 cup), leftover coffee (about 1/2 cup), some splenda, 1 packet of Diet Hot chocolate mix (only 25 calories), and a little Davinci SF Syrup (whatever flavor you like). I put in a big jug and just shake it until mixed well and poured it over ice. It was pretty good and only 125 calories. You could always add chocolate Protein powder instead of the hot chocolate mix if you wanted.
